LESSON PLAN IN SCIENCE VI

I. Objective: Determine the distinguishing characteristics of vertebrates.

II. Subject Matter: Characteristics of Each Group of Vertebrates


A. Materials: Pictures, chart, flashcards, power point presentation
B. References: Headways in Science and Health pp. 71-76
Curriculum Guide in Science 6 MT-lle-f-3
C. Value Focus: LOVE FOR ANIMALS

IV. EVALUATION Write the letter of the correct Pupils answer the questions on
answer for the distinguishing their paper.
characteristics of group of
Vertebrates.

1. They are cold - blooded


vertebrates hatched from egg. They
have dry scaly skin and some have
shells.
A. Reptiles C. Mammals
B. Amphibians D. Fish

2. They are cold - blooded animals


covered with scales.
A. Reptiles C. Birds
B. Fish D. Mammals

3. They are warm blooded animals


that are born alive or viviparous.
They feed their young with milk.
A. Fish C. Mammals
B. Birds D. Reptiles

4. They have a pair of limbs for


hopping and a pair of wings to fly.
A. Bird C. Mammals
B. Fish D. Amphibians

5. They spend part of their lives in


water and part on land. They have
moist and scaleless skin.
A. Fish C. Amphibians
B. Birds D. Mammals
